[GitHub] [hadoop] 9uapaw commented on pull request #3225: YARN-10869. CS considers only the default maximum-allocation-mb/vcore…

Posted by GitBox <gi...@apache.org>.
9uapaw commented on pull request #3225:
URL: https://github.com/apache/hadoop/pull/3225#issuecomment-885565454


   Thank you for the patch @bteke. This is a subtle issue, good finding! One note:
   Is there any drawbacks of not using cloned configuration objects?  I can see that the initializeLeafQueueConfigs also clones the config object, and so does the getLeafQueueConfigs (which is doubly meaningless, as it is creating a new Configuration object which is passed to a new CSConfiguration object immediately). I would argue that in order to eliminate the root cause of this issue is to remove these clonings, if they are not essential. As of now, I do not see any advantages of  this behaviour over simply populating the csContext config with the templates.
